"Nevermore shall you wonder what it might have been like to fall deeply in love with Edgar Allan Poe. In 1845 Manhattan, the author was the 19th century version of a rock star, and the poetess who narrates this novel witnesses the smashing success of The Raven even as Poe’s consumptive child-bride languishes. Famous personages, from Walt Whitman to Margaret Fuller to Mathew Brady, make cameos at New York’s literary soirees, its “kissing bridges,” Niblo’s Garden and healthful East River swimming parties. Romance blooms in a city where green meadows are turning overnight into row houses. Lynn Cullen’s Mrs. Poe nails the period."
